The Role of Crypto Data Analytics in the Digital Currency Market

The digital currency market has experienced explosive growth over the past few years, driven by the rising popularity of c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in, Ethereum, and many others. As this sector continues to evolve, so does the importance of crypto data analytics. This article explores the critical role that data analytics plays in the digital currency market, highlighting its significance in investment decisions, market trends, and risk management.

Crypto data analytics refers to the process of collecting and analyzing vast amounts of data related to cryptocurrencies. This can include historical prices, transaction volumes, market cap, and social media sentiment. With the correct tools and methodologies, investors can uncover trends and insights that would otherwise remain hidden. The data-driven approach has become an essential asset for traders and investors looking to navigate the volatile landscape of cryptocurrencies.

One of the primary advantages of crypto data analytics is the ability to make informed investment decisions. With real-time data and advanced analytics, traders can identify patterns and predict market movements with greater accuracy. For instance, by analyzing price trends, volume changes, and external factors like regulation announcements, investors can time their buys and sells more effectively. This capability is especially crucial in a market known for its rapid fluctuations and unpredictable nature.

Market sentiment analysis is another valuable component of crypto data analytics. By examining social media platforms, news articles, and community forums, analysts can gauge public sentiment toward a particular cryptocurrency. Positive or negative sentiment can significantly impact price movements. Consequently, understanding these emotions allows investors to anticipate potential surges or declines in value. Tools that aggregate social media data and analyze sentiment are becoming increasingly common in the crypto investment toolkit.

Moreover, data analytics plays a vital role in risk management within the digital currency market. Given the high stakes involved in cryptocurrency trading, having a solid risk management strategy is essential. Analysts utilize various risk assessment models and metrics to evaluate potential risks associated with specific trades or investments. By factoring in volatility, market correlations, and historical performance, investors can make data-driven decisions that align with their risk tolerance.

The integration of advanced technologies, such as machine learning and artificial intelligence, has further enhanced the effectiveness of crypto data analytics. These technologies allow analysts to process and analyze data on a scale and speed that would be impossible manually. Machine learning algorithms can identify complex patterns and correlations, enabling investors to refine their strategies continuously.
